We do not observe an obvious trend between gene expression magnitude and the presence of predicted off-target probes ( Figure 2C ), suggesting that off-target binding prediction alone does not explain the observed higher expression magnitude in Xenium compared to Visium, which may still be attributed to variation in detection efficiency, sequencing depth, and other factors.
